Wartburg 311, built in 1956, registered on 4 November 1957, first owner was Herbert Köfer, a well-known DEFA actor. Wartburg was the trade name of the passenger car series manufactured by IFA at the VEB Automobilwerk Eisenach from 1956 to 1991. The name is derived from the castle of the same name at the production site in Eisenach, Erfurt, Thuringia, Germany, Europe
